Chipping services involve the careful removal of small sections of concrete, asphalt, or other hard surfaces to repair damage or prepare for further work. This process is often used to eliminate cracks, surface imperfections, or deteriorated areas that can compromise the integrity or appearance of a driveway, patio, sidewalk, or other paved surfaces. Skilled contractors use specialized tools to chip away damaged material without affecting the surrounding areas, ensuring a clean and precise repair. This service provides an effective way to address surface issues without the need for complete replacement, making it a practical choice for many property owners.

Chipping services help resolve common problems such as cracking, spalling, and surface erosion that can develop over time due to weather, heavy use, or ground movement.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to larger cracks, uneven surfaces, or even safety hazards like tripping. By removing damaged sections, local contractors can prepare the surface for patching, sealing, or resurfacing, which restores both safety and visual appeal. This approach is especially useful for preventing minor issues from escalating into more costly repairs or replacements down the line.

The overview below groups typical Chipping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bergen County,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or chipping or cracking repairs typ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. These projects usually involve small sections or surface fixes handled efficiently by local contractors.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this range, which may involve more extensive surface work.

Moderate Chipping Services - Medium-sized chipping projects, such as partial surface repairs or localized damage, generally fall in the $600-$1,500 range. Many jobs in this band are common, with some larger or more complex repairs approaching $2,000+ depending on scope.

Full Chipping Service - Complete surface chipping or repair of larger areas often costs between $1,500 and $3,500. These projects are less frequent but are typical for extensive damage or older surfaces needing significant work by local service providers.

Full Replacement - Replacing an entire surface or large sections can range from $3,500 to $8,000 or more, especially for larger, more complex projects. While more costly, these jobs are less common and usually involve substantial structural or surface work handled by experienced local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
